International Conference on eXtended Reality (XR Salento 2026)


XR Salento gathers global experts to share cutting-edge research and industrial achievements in immersive technology. Set in the historic coastal town of Otranto, the conference fosters interdisciplinary collaboration to expand the boundaries of human perception.

We are excited to contribute to this year's scientific program, where our team will be presenting two research papers detailing our latest work in the field.

Samuel Dossche will present research on using Electrodermal Activity (EDA) to create adaptive VR horror experiences that tailor intensity to individual players in real time. His work demonstrates how anticipatory build-ups can effectively manage sustained player tension, providing an empirical foundation for designing more personalized and intelligent immersive environments.
